[[preprinted]] Saturday, September 8, 1910 [[/preprinted]]

My old friend Kersondass actually bought something this morning! He doesn't know it, but I really stuck him an extra rupee a bale for making me wait so long.

Weighing up goatskins this morning. If you think it's any fun to weigh 1500 skins, one by each, you are mistaken, kind sir. And all for 2 1/2%! If they don't stick Corey another 7 1/2% on the other side, they're lobsters, that's all. The skin game ought to live up to it's name.

3 years out today!!

[[preprinted]] Sunday, September 4, 1910 [[/preprinted]]

Nothing much diddin' this afternoon, so I went out to Bububu. It is one of the emoluments of the job that I'm a deadhead on the Zanzibar Railroad, by the way. Vining is a bloomin' stockholder. When they formed the road in New York for the purpose of getting Benine by the topknot, they were short of the legal number of stockholders, so they passed out a couple each to the office force. Wish I'd been around when old Jno. D. fixed up his oil Co. I do, if the same dasturi was on in his works! Oh well, we can't all be Chancellors up at Syracuse, I s'pose.
